Instructions

  1. Toast bread until golden and crispy.
  2. Mash avocado with l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Spread generously on toast.
  3. Cook eggs to your preference (poached recommended for creaminess).
  4. Place egg on top of avocado toast. Season with extra salt, pepper, and desired toppings. Serve immediately.

Note

Use ripe but firm avocados for best texture.
